Where is 29A Hastie Street located within the Tolga area?

29A Hastie Street is in the rural town of Tolga on the Atherton Tableland in Queensland’s Tablelands Region. The town is traversed by the Kennedy Highway and lies in the southern part of the locality.

What notable attractions or landmarks are near the property?

Tolga is famous for the Big Peanut, a large roadside landmark representing the town’s peanut industry. The Tolga Markets are held each first Sunday of the month at the Tolga Racecourse, and heritage sites such as the Bones Knob Radar Station and Rocky Creek WWII Hospital Complex are also nearby.

How far is the property from the Tolga Post Office?

The Tolga Post Office is approximately 0.1 km from 29A Hastie Street, making it a very short walk away.

What is the current population of Tolga?

According to the 2021 census, the locality of Tolga had a population of 3,177 people.

What is the main industry in Tolga?

Tolga serves as the centre of the region’s peanut industry and is home to the iconic Big Peanut attraction.

Are there any community groups or activities nearby?

The Tolga branch of the Queensland Country Women’s Association meets at the QCWA Hall on Main Street, providing a local hub for community events and gatherings.
